Directions
- Prepare the Filling: In a mixing bowl, blend softened cream cheese, Parmesan, mayonnaise, garlic powder, onion powder, black pepper, and thoroughly drained spinach. Mix until it reaches a smooth and creamy consistency.
- Roll Out Pastry: On a lightly floured surface, unroll the puff pastry sheet. Spread the spinach mixture evenly over the pastry, leaving a small margin at one edge to create a seal when rolled.
- Form the Log: Starting from the edge with the filling, tightly roll the pastry towards the empty edge. Ensure it’s snug to maintain its shape while baking.
- Chill: Wrap the rolled pastry log in plastic wrap and place it in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es.
- Preheat Oven: While the log chills, pre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Slice & Brush: Once chilled, remove the log from the fridge and slice it into half-inch rounds. Arrange them on the prepared baking sheet. Beat an egg with a splash of water, then brush it over the tops and sides of each pinwheel.
- Bake: Place the baking sheet in the oven and bake for 15-20 minutes, until the pinwheels are puffed and golden brown. Let them cool slightly before serving.
